Inclusion criteria[edit]

As stated at Wikipedia:Stand-alone lists, Wikipedia:Notability#Stand-alone lists and Wikipedia:Manual of Style/Lists#Adding individual items to a list:-

  1. All lists must have clearly defined inclusion criteria
  2. Every entry should meet the notability criteria for its own article. Red-linked entries are acceptable if the entry is verifiably a member of the list, and it is reasonable to expect an article could be forthcoming in the future. This prevents indiscriminate lists, and prevents individual lists from being too large to be useful to readers.
  3. Editors may, at their discretion, choose to limit large lists by only including entries for independently notable items or those with Wikipedia articles.
  4. All list entries must follow Wikipedia's core content policies of Verifiability (by citing reliable sources as references), No original research, and Neutral point of view

This list fails most of these requirements in that:-

  • There are no clearly defined inclusion criteria
  • Many of the entries are not "verifiably a member of the list" in that they have neither an article nor a reference
  • As per the above rules, all redlinks, without a citation, should be removed
  • There are no redlinks with a citation so those provisos are irrelevant
  • I will, therefore, remove the redlinks as per the above rationale - Arjayay (talk) 12:43, 7 November 2022 (UTC)[reply]
